The district People’s Committee vice chairman Pham Van Loi, said based on the new poverty line, the locality has 919 out of 32,464 poor households, accounting for 2.83%, of which Phu Chanh, Tan Thanh and Hieu Liem communes have a poverty rate of over 5%.

Vegetable growing helps many families escape poverty.
Loi explained that most of the poor households live on agriculture. However, owing to bad weather and price hike, these poor households encounter many more difficulties.
Therefore, the district party committee and authority have launched supportive programs for local poor households. Since the start of this year, Tan Uyen district mobilized nearly VND19bil to offer loans for over 5,000 poor families to reinforce production as well as opened 16 vocational training classes for rural laborers.
Moreover, the district has introduced jobs to 2,899 laborers and helped 90 households escape poverty. In addition, Tan Uyen district has granted 25 hi-unity houses for local disadvantaged families.
The locality has made greater efforts to reduce 159 poor households in this year. Pham Van Loi added that the locality has headed for sustainable poverty reduction.
